Pan-seared Salmon Recipe

Inspired by Clos Maggiore
Time30m
Serves4

With Asparagus and Lemon Butter Sauce

Method

Cooking Instructions

  1. 1

    Prepare the Asparagus

    Trim the ends of the asparagus and set aside.

  2. 2

    Season the Salmon

    Pat the salmon fillets dry and season both sides with salt and black pepper.

  3. 3

    Cook the Salmon

    In a large skillet, heat olive oil over medium-high heat. Add the salmon fillets, skin-side down, and cook for 4-5 minutes until the skin is crispy. Flip and cook for another 3-4 minutes until the salmon is cooked through. Remove from the skillet and keep warm.

  4. 4

    Sauté the Asparagus

    In the same skillet, add the asparagus and sauté for 3-4 minutes until tender-crisp. Remove and set aside.

  5. 5

    Make the Lemon Butter Sauce

    In the same skillet, reduce the heat to medium and add butter. Once melted, add minced garlic and lemon juice, stirring until well combined. Cook for an additional minute.

  6. 6

    Serve

    Plate the salmon and asparagus, and drizzle the lemon butter sauce over the top before serving.
